aboutsummaryrefslogtreecommitdiff
path: root/lldb/source/API/SBQueue.cpp
diff options
context:
space:
mode:
authorJason Molenda <jmolenda@apple.com>2013-12-18 00:58:23 +0000
committerJason Molenda <jmolenda@apple.com>2013-12-18 00:58:23 +0000
commitb97f44d9ef0828254e7e82d30f9f9d65c9d181dd (patch)
tree269038e95b22bc3c103001e3819b369aac870daf /lldb/source/API/SBQueue.cpp
parent1b30b593ba1ff68205761ca372e85781b2bbbc41 (diff)
downloadllvm-b97f44d9ef0828254e7e82d30f9f9d65c9d181dd.zip
llvm-b97f44d9ef0828254e7e82d30f9f9d65c9d181dd.tar.gz
llvm-b97f44d9ef0828254e7e82d30f9f9d65c9d181dd.tar.bz2
Fix how Queue/QueueItem weak pointers are initialized in the ctors.
llvm-svn: 197541
Diffstat (limited to 'lldb/source/API/SBQueue.cpp')
-rw-r--r--lldb/source/API/SBQueue.cpp3
1 files changed, 2 insertions, 1 deletions
diff --git a/lldb/source/API/SBQueue.cpp b/lldb/source/API/SBQueue.cpp
index 7573cd2..0b60a69 100644
--- a/lldb/source/API/SBQueue.cpp
+++ b/lldb/source/API/SBQueue.cpp
@@ -38,12 +38,13 @@ namespace lldb_private
}
QueueImpl (const lldb::QueueSP &queue_sp) :
- m_queue_wp(queue_sp),
+ m_queue_wp(),
m_threads(),
m_thread_list_fetched(false),
m_items(),
m_queue_items_fetched(false)
{
+ m_queue_wp = queue_sp;
}
QueueImpl (const QueueImpl &rhs)